AfricaCom, Cape Town, South Africa, 11 November 2009 - AIRCOM International, the leading independent network planning and optimisation consultancy, today announced its selection by Zain Ghana, to help design and plan Zain’s network migration from 2G to 3.5G. Accra, Sep.3, GNA - Zain Ghana, Emitac Mobile Solutions (EMS) and Research in Motion (RIM) have introduced the world's first clickable touch screen smartphone known as the Blackberry solution in Ghana. The Blackberry solution brings together smartphones, software, and services to allow easy wireless access to E-mail, phone, calendar, web, multimedia and other business and lifestyle applications. Apparently in a bid to rival MTN Ghana's mtnloaded.com.gh, Zain Ghana is launching its own content portal for its subscribers. The competition on the mobile front in Ghana has been between MTN and Zain in recent times. There is a problem however. The web address Zain is advertising doesn't belong to them and doesn't contain any Zain content. The domain zainportal.com is just a parked domain littered with ads. In Ghana today, most Internet users rely on traditional Internet Service Providers (ISPs) and Internet cafes, and few bother about Internet on mobiles. Long before mobile phones became popular in Ghana, fixed lines offered by the national operator Vodafone Ghana (then known as Ghana Telecom) and to a limited extent WESTEL, were widespread among businesses, government offices, organizations and private homes of the elite.
